What You'll Be Doing
As a Cable Technician, you will work in the field to install and service modern cable and fiber optic systems. Key responsibilities include:
Install, troubleshoot, and maintain fiber optic and coaxial cable systems
Perform precise splicing of coaxial and fiber optic cables of various sizes and types
Complete splicing for:
Aerial and underground installations
Span replacements
Single-dwelling units (SDUs)
Small to medium-sized businesses (SMBs)
Relocation and upgrade projects
Identify, repair, and replace damaged or outdated fiber infrastructure
Diagnose and resolve connectivity and signal issues
Perform live splicing on active equipment with minimal service disruption
Measure, test, and document signal strength for internet, television, and phone services
Evaluate job sites and proactively address safety, quality, and installation risks
Maintain accurate records, including network layouts, schematics, and service documentation
Educate customers on installed services and assist with basic equipment setup
